as posted by the channelA wave of officetoapartment conversions is coming to midtown Manhattan, providing relief to New York’s housing shortage. Natalie Wong reports Read more
New York’s housing crisis has also come into stark focus as the city prepares for a heated mayoral election in November. Zohran Mamdani, who won the Democratic primary, has been pushing to freeze rents on the city’s stock of rent-stabilized apartments. That could throw a wrench into developers’ calculations on projects, as many companies are relying on a tax break that requires them to include those types of units in their buildings.
